Dog Exercise, The Best Way To Bond With Your HuskyThe best way to connect with your husky is through dog exercise. Why? To a husky, exercise equates happiness. That means if you provide exercise, your husky can actually pay attention. In reality, we are lucky to get home from work with enough energy (mental or physical) for a 30 minute walk. So if you can provide thinking games and mental stimulation for you husky both while you are home and while you are at work, you can combat the exercise junkie in your dog. Chew toys, bully sticks, and bones are great entertainment while you are at work. Once you get home - if exercising your husky isn't any fun for you it won't be fun for your dog. In order to stay motivated, you have to mix it up! Set Up A Small Obstacle Course Leash your husky and head outside. Now check out your backyard. Do you have anything you could use for a small obstacle course? A couple five of gallon buckets? A few logs intended for the fireplace? Set the logs about 5 feet apart in a straight line. At first just weave in and out of the logs with your husky following you. Is she afraid? Use this as something to work on. Walk around the logs in a pattern like a figure 8. Once in awhile jump over a log. The goal of this dog exercise is to have her follow you NOT accomplish the figure eight or the jumping. The figure eight is just a way to make following you interesting. When you have a pattern to focus on, your husky will have focus. Add obstacles one at a time as your dog starts to follow you without a lot of distraction. Change the pattern often, don't be predictable (i.e. boring). Dog Exercise Training Tip Your dog won't tell you when he's had enough. Especially a husky. They will pull and run themselves even if they are overheated or hurt. So make sure you stop the dog exercise while your dog is still enjoying himself.
